Alan Buchanan – Independent Financial Adviser Alan is a dedicated professional with over 40 years’ experience in the Financial Services Industry as an Independent Adviser. Over the years, he has gained a wealth of knowledge of all aspects of Financial Services, from pensions and investment advice to group insurance risks and business protection. Alan prides himself on being approachable and honest. He is intent on continuing to build on our relationships with clients and their families. Alan is highly trusted and offers support and advice to generation after generation. Over the years, Alan has gained numerous qualifications, the most notable of which was becoming a Fellow of the Chartered Insurance Institute (1983) and later as regulations increased, a Pension Transfer Specialist. A Fellow is the Chartered Insurance Institute’s highest membership level so you can be sure that the advice Alan offers is top quality. Jack Buchanan – Independent Financial Adviser Jack began working with Alan, after completing his A-Levels, as an Administrator. Jack built up his knowledge of the financial services industry by supporting Alan in handling client affairs. As the years progressed, Jack assumed more responsibility within the firm, focusing on broader fund research and management of client reviews. He has gained multiple qualifications, including the LIBF Level 4 Diploma for Financial Advisers in 2018. Jack enjoys talking to clients and is always on hand to answer technical queries. Outside of work, Jack is a keen hockey player and is currently Captain of the First Team at Sale Hockey Club.

Lydia Buchanan – Independent Financial Adviser Lydia joined the family business in October 2020 after completing her Masters in Business Strategy and her Law Degree from Lancaster University. Alongside learning all aspects of the business, she achieved the LIBF Level 4 Diploma for Financial Advisers in September 2021. Being very much a people person, her favourite part of the job is meeting clients and discussing their individual needs. Lydia is looking to specialise in intergenerational wealth management and, having an interest for positive social change, investing responsibly and sustainably.
